2. Attribution
Comprehensive attribution data enables marketing experts to recognize high-performing networks and change budgets accordingly. It also enables teams to create and test new marketing techniques from a combined analytics report, such as utilizing gated material with cold emailing campaigns to attract high-value prospects sooner.

UTM parameters are important for granular attribution reporting. They can consist of numerous identifiers, consisting of the project name and tool utilized to track website traffic. They can additionally consist of a term, which can be utilized to manually identify paid key words for PPC projects, and web content, which can be used to differentiate different versions of the same piece of advertising and marketing web content for A/B screening.

Adding these identifiers to links can be a little time-consuming, yet it deserves the couple of seconds to ensure you're obtaining exact, informative analytics reports from your digital advertising and marketing initiatives. Inconsistent or ambiguous parameters can bring about deceptive data, so it is essential to establish clear calling conventions and stick to them across the group.

4. Cross-Channel Advertising and marketing
Utilizing UTM criteria properly aids marketing professionals track off-site and on-site marketing campaigns, revealing traffic resources in their analytics device. This offers beneficial insights that can cause better campaign preparation and budget allowance.

For example, if you're running several projects to drive brand-new users to your web site, you can label any type of social media sites messages or electronic advertising and marketing links with a utm_campaign code like "bfcm". When you take a look at the Procurement - Source/Medium record in Google Analytics, this will assist you determine the details channel that drove web traffic and conversions to your website.

In a similar way, you can use utm_content tags to develop and track gated web content like whitepapers or e-books. These tagged links supply intent information, allowing online marketers to get to high-value leads and raise their chances of conversion.
